Dawn Angelique Richard Wiki Biography
Dawn Angelique Richard was born on 5 August 1983, in New Orleans, Louisiana, USA, of Haitian and Creole descent. Dawn is a singer and songwriter probably best known for being part of “Danity Kane” and “Diddy-Dirty Money”. She is also known for her solo career and all her efforts have helped put her net worth to where it is today.

At an early age, Richard was exposed to music as his father was the former percussionist and lead singer of “Chocolate Milk”. Her mother was the owner of a dancing school and so Dawn developed both her dancing and singing skills. As a teenager, she joined the group “Realiti” and was discovered during one of her performances. She was signed under the name Dawn Angelique by Yeah! Brother Records, an independent record label. She created a solo album entitled “Been a While” which was co-produced by Ne-Yo. However, some difficulties with Sean “Diddy” Combs and Bad Boy Records saw the album release delayed . She then toured, doing live performances, and also found work as a cheerleader for the New Orleans Hornets.
In 2005 she auditioned for “Making the Band”, a TV show, and was given the chance to compete for a new girl group managed by Sean Combs. She was released from Yeah! Brother Records and signed with Bad Boy Worldwide Entertainment. She, along with Aundrea Fimbres, Wanita Woodgett (D. Woods), Shannon Bex and Aubrey O’Day would become “Danity Kane”; the group idea came from Dawn who was a fan of comics and manga. As the band went on with their performances, Richard also started to work with various artists such as Cherri V, and then released the song “Phase” which featured Lil Wayne. The band continued to release songs while Dawn worked on an untitled comic book, which was eventually entitled “Danity Kane”.
In 2009, the group split up but Dawn had hoped to continue the band. She then started to work with Sean Combs and Cassie to create “Diddy-Dirt Money”. Dawn became the first member of “Danity Kane” to have released music under a major label after their split. She continued to work on her own mixtape entitled “The Prelude To A Tell Tale Heart”. Dawn then released a few songs, promoting the mixtape and an official studio album. In 2012, she released a promotional single entitled “SMFU (Save Me From U)”, and it came with other songs such as “Black Lipstick” and “Fly”. She continued to promote her songs until the eventual release of the album “Armor On”. The album was said to be a trilogy and she started to work on the second album entitled “GoldenHeart”. This album was released in January 2013, with Dawn releasing it independently. It became number two on the Top Heatseekers Album Chart and number 10 on the Top R&B/Hip-Hop Album Chart. She was supposedly going to preview the album “BlackHeart”, the final album of the trilogy, but prioritized the reunion of “Danity Kane”. All the remaining members agreed that they would reunite without Sean “P. Diddy” Combs, and they started to release a few songs, and then Dawn announced the release of “Blackheart”. She is currently working on the album “The Red Era’ and her tour “REDEMPTION”.
For her personal life it is known that Dawn had a relationship with Qwanell Mosley and it lasted for five years. According to her it was his infidelity that broke them up. Dawn is also a vegan and even posed for a PETA ad naked.

1 | Went to De la Salle High school in New Orleans with Marquise Hill, an NFL defensive lineman who passed away in the summer of 2006, and Holland Diaz stunt double for Tobey McGuire in Spider-Man 3. |
2 | Dawn draws anime, and one drawing in particular caught the attention of Diddy. When asked what the character's name was she replied "Danity Kane". It was a female superhero she drew while Danity Kane was in the studio, and to Diddy this represented the girls of Making The Band 3. Diddy then decided it would be the name of the group. |
3 | Her mother owned a dancing school where Dawn spent much of her childhood developing her skills at choreography and singing. |
4 | Due to Hurricane Katrina, Dawn and her family now reside in Baltimore, Maryland. |
